How they compare
Uruguay currently reports 25,715 against 25,570 in Singapore, a difference of 145.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 26 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Uruguay ahead.
Singapore ranks 131st and Uruguay ranks 129th of 191 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Singapore averaged higher in 2 and Uruguay in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Singapore | Uruguay |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 23,322 | 26,976 | 3,653 | Uruguay |
| 2000s | 33,052 | 27,280 | 5,773 | Singapore |
| 2010s | 29,169 | 26,201 | 2,968 | Singapore |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
